However, installing a cat flap in a uPVC door is a challenge for homeowners who aren't experts. However, there are methods to make it easier. First, you need to take measurements of your pet's height. This will help you determine the ideal height at which to install the cat flap. Then, you need to mark the desired shape on the uPVC panel. It could be either a square or a circle. Also, make sure that the mark and the cut are straight.

Once you have marked the uPVC sheet and cut it into the shape with the help of a jigsaw. Make sure you are using a fine cutting blade typically made to be used with uPVC or metal. This will ensure that you don't damage the door's material.

In some instances, it might be necessary for an iron saw to cut the desired shape from a uPVC sheet. If this is the case, be sure to wear a face mask. You could end up inhaling some of the chemicals that are used in the manufacture of uPVC panel.

You can also buy a new uPVC sheet with a hole already cut for the flap. It can be bought from a specialist company. In this instance, the uPVC panel will be installed in place of the existing glass sealed unit. The cost for this service is between PS100 -PS200.

Fitting a cat flap to your uPVC door panel is relatively easy. It's doable to do it yourself. However, it is recommended to do it slowly. It's essential to ensure that the hole you drill is the right dimension and that it's sealed to stop cold air from getting in and warm air from escaping.

Alternately, you can employ a professional glazier to install pet flaps onto your UPVC half-door panel for you. This is usually less expensive particularly if your door needs to be glassed. Be aware that a double-glazed sealed unit is not permitted to be fitted with a cat flap since it could cause the seal to break opening up air into your home.

Adding a cat flap can be a difficult task. This is due to the fact that double glazed panels are sealed and cutting into them is dangerous. This could also harm the insulation properties of the door, allowing moisture to enter. As temperatures fluctuate, condensation will develop between the glass panes.

You can, however, install a pet flap into the uPVC door panel without having to replace the entire unit. It is crucial to find a professional who can install the flap inside an alternative window. They can also remove the glass pane and replace it with an unbreakable uPVC panel that is cheaper than a new door. You could also ask your glaziers to install the flap in a door that has the pane removed. This is more expensive than replacing the old glass pane, but it might be worth the extra cost for those who want to save money in the long run.
